
Joe Bellhouse
Joe is a Partner in the Construction team specialising in procurement and development of construction and engineering projects. He has particular expertise in advising on property developments (including offices, warehouses, hotels, retail, sports stadia, business parks, residential), energy projects, process plant, highways and bridges, ports, and other engineering projects. Joe is also experienced in providing entirely original drafting or using and amending industry standard form contracts, including JCT, NEC, FIDIC, MF/1 and IChemE contracts. With a background in dispute resolution, Joe is adept at guiding clients through project risks/challenges and developing strategies for any potential issues or disputes before they arise. He also advises on contract claims, negotiation of settlements, and support in connection with formal proceedings including adjudication and arbitration. · Keystone Law
